New Space Marine Codex available?

The Space Marine files are being worked on, and have been for some time. The guys working on them are volunteers who have a life outside of creating the files, and the new codex requires pretty much a ground up rewrite. It has gone through a couple of rounds of internal testing and issues are being worked on before they can be released. There isn't an ETA, it's a "when it's done" and that's all I can say on it right now.

And it's not just the Space Marine codex being worked on. What many of you may not be aware of is how this impacts other lists - for instance, Imperial Armour lists that share units with the Marines, other Marine variant codexes that partially share units; these have to be worked on too, it's not just a case of slapping together a few files for one codex.

Also to address Kikasstou's post - the volunteer groups who create the files do not get paid. When you pay for AB, you pay for the software itself.
